School Description and Mission Statement (School Year 2019–2020)
STEM Prep Elementary is part of the STEM Prep family of schools, which is committed to disrupting the status quo of inequitable access to high quality STEM pathways for women and minorities by closing the socio-economic, ethnic, and gender gaps in STEM fields, and serving as role models who exhibit scholarliness, advocacy, perseverance, and kindness.
The mission of STEM Prep Schools is
...to operate a small network of high performing schools, in a targeted area of Los Angeles
...and develop K – 12th grade scholars into successful college graduates and professionals,
...through equal access and inspiration, rigorous curriculum, and a commitment to our core values.
